上架app服务
上架app服务是指将开发好的应用程序上传到应用商店或其他平台,供用户下载和使用的过程。该服务是移动应用开发的重要环节之一,也是推广应用的重要手段。下面将介绍上架app服务的原理和详细步骤。一、原理上架app服务的原理是将开发好的应用程序打包成一个安装包,然后上传到应用商店或其他平台。用户通过应用商店或其他平台...
2023-11-28 围观 : 1次
在iOS开发中,上架测试版APP是非常重要的一步。通过测试版,我们可以让一部分用户先体验我们的APP并给出反馈,以便我们进行优化和完善。本文将介绍如何上架测试版APP,包括注册开发者账号、创建APP ID、创建证书、创建设备ID、创建测试版APP以及上传APP到App Store Connect等步骤。
1. 注册开发者账号
首先,我们需要在苹果官方网站上注册一个开发者账号。注册过程需要提供一些基本信息,如姓名、地址、电话号码等。注册成功后,我们需要在开发者中心中选择“Enroll”进入开发者计划的申请页面。选择“iOS Developer Program”并按照提示完成付款等流程即可。
2. 创建APP ID
在开发者中心中,我们需要创建一个APP ID,这个ID将用于标识我们的APP。在创建APP ID时,我们需要选择一个唯一的Bundle Identifier,这个标识符是由我们自己定义的,一般格式为“com.companyname.appname”。创建完成后,我们需要为APP ID启用一些服务,如推送通知、iCloud等。
3. 创建证书
为了保护我们的APP的安全性,我们需要创建一个证书。证书用于证明我们的APP是由我们自己开发的,并且没有被篡改。创建证书需要在开发者中心中选择“Certificates, Identifiers & Profiles”,然后选择“Certificates”,点击“+”按钮创建一个新的证书。证书有两种类型,分别是开发证书和发布证书,我们需要根据不同的需求选择不同的证书类型。
4. 创建设备ID
在进行测试之前,我们需要将测试设备的UDID添加到我们的开发者账号中。UDID是设备的唯一标识符,我们可以在设备的设置中找到它。在开发者中心中,我们需要选择“Devices”,然后点击“+”按钮添加一个新的设备ID。输入设备的名称和UDID即可。
5. 创建测试版APP
在Xcode中,我们可以通过选择“Product”->“Archive”来创建一个测试版的APP。在创建APP时,我们需要选择之前创建的APP ID和证书,以及要进行测试的设备ID。在创建完成后,我们可以在Xcode的“Window”->“Organizer”中查看已创建的APP,也可以导出APP以备上传。
6. 上传APP到App Store Connect
最后,我们需要将测试版APP上传到App Store Connect中。在App Store Connect中,我们需要选择“My Apps”->“+”按钮创建一个新的APP,然后填写APP的基本信息,如名称、描述、图标等。在上传APP时,我们需要选择刚刚导出的APP文件,并填写版本号、构建号等信息。上传完成后,我们可以邀请测试人员进行测试,并收集他们的反馈。
总结
以上就是上架iOS测试版APP的全部步骤,需要注意的是,每个步骤都需要仔细操作,并且需要对开发者账号、证书、APP ID等进行正确的配置。通过上架测试版APP,我们可以让用户提前体验我们的APP,以便我们进行优化和完善。
上架app服务是指将开发好的应用程序上传到应用商店或其他平台,供用户下载和使用的过程。该服务是移动应用开发的重要环节之一,也是推广应用的重要手段。下面将介绍上架app服务的原理和详细步骤。一、原理上架app服务的原理是将开发好的应用程序打包成一个安装包,然后上传到应用商店或其他平台。用户通过应用商店或其他平台...
uniapp是一款跨平台的开发框架,它可以帮助开发者快速地实现多个平台的应用程序开发。在开发完成后,我们需要进行打包处理,将应用程序打包成不同平台的可执行文件。本文将介绍如何将uniapp应用程序打包成苹果端的ipa文件,并进行上架。一、打包uniapp应用程序1. 安装Xcode在进行iOS打包之...
应用商城是指提供应用程序下载和安装的电子商务平台,用户可以在这里下载、更新和管理自己的应用程序。应用商城的出现,极大地方便了人们的生活和工作,也促进了移动互联网的发展。那么,如何在应用商城上架自己的应用程序呢?下面将详细介绍。一、选择应用商城首先,需要根据自己的应用程序类型和目标用户群体选择应用商城...
在移动应用开发过程中,应用上架前测试是非常重要的一环节。它可以帮助开发者发现和修复应用中的各种问题,确保应用顺利通过应用商店的审核并提供良好的用户体验。下面将详细介绍应用上架前测试的原理和步骤。一、测试原理应用上架前测试的主要目的是发现应用中的各种问题,例如崩溃、功能异常、性能问题等等。测试的原理是...
Fluent是一款非常流行的英语学习应用程序,它提供了丰富的课程和学习材料,帮助用户提高英语听说读写能力。自从Fluent上架苹果之后,越来越多的用户开始使用Fluent进行学习。那么,Fluent是如何上架苹果的呢?下面将为大家介绍一下Fluent上架苹果的原理和详细过程。一、Fluent上架苹果...